在lombok库中包含相关注解,通过该注解快速实现类的构造器、访问方法get和设置方法set,如@Data、@Builder、@NoArgsConstructor、@AllArgsConstructor、@getter、@setter、Accessors(chain=true)、@Value等。 @Data:@Data是一个复合注解(@Setter、@Getter、@ToString、@EqualsAndHashCode、@NoArgsConstructor),使用在类中,会...
在Java中,Set是一个不允许重复元素的集合。以下是一些常用的Set方法: add(E e): 向集合中添加一个元素。如果集合已经包含该元素,则返回false。 remove(Object o): 从集合中删除指定对象。如果集合中不存在该对象,则返回false。 contains(Object o): 检查集合中是否包含指定对象。如果包含,则返回true,否则返回fal...
// 创建一个HashSet实例Set<String>list=newHashSet<>();// 添加元素list.add("Apple");list.add("Banana");list.add("Cherry");// 尝试添加重复元素,不会添加成功list.add("Apple");// 输出HashSet中的元素System.out.println(list);// 检查元素是否存在System.out.println("'Banana'是否存在? "+li...
Set集合中的元素都是唯一的,不允许有重复值,且最多只允许包含一个null元素;Set集合中的元素没有顺序,我们无法通过索引来访问元素,但TreeSet是有序的;Set集合没有固定的大小限制,可以动态地添加和删除元素;Set集合提供了高效的元素查找和判断方法。3. Set常用方法 Set集合给我们提供了一系列常用的方法,用于...
按照定义,Set 接口继承 Collection 接口,而且它不允许集合中存在重复项。所有原始方法都是现成的,没有引入新方法。具体的 Set 实现类依赖添加的对象的 equals() 方法来检查等同性。 各个方法的作用描述: public int size() :返回set中元素的数目,如果set包含的元素数大于Integer.MAX_VALUE,返回Integer.MAX_VALUE;...
51CTO博客已为您找到关于java get和set方法的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及java get和set方法问答内容。更多java get和set方法相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
一、set方法的概念和作用 set方法是一种用于设置类的属性值的方法,通常用于封装类的私有属性。通过set方法,我们可以在类的外部设置该属性的值,同时可以在方法内部对属性值进行逻辑判断和处理。set方法的命名通常以“set”开头,后面跟着属性名,首字母大写。例如,如果属性名为“name”,那么对应的set方法命名为“setName...
1 Set集合介绍 Collection接口可以存放重复元素,也可以存放不重复元素。List可以存放重复元素,Set就是不重复的元素。 通过元素的equals方法,来判断是否为重复元素。 Set集合取出元素的方式可以采用:迭代器,增强 for 2 HashSet(哈希表) 此类实现了Set接口,由哈希表(实际是HashMap实例)支持。它不保证set的迭代顺序,特别...
get和set方法是一种常用的编程规范,用于访问和修改对象的属性。 使用get方法可以获取对象的属性值,而set方法则用于设置属性值。 通过使用get和set方法,可以有效地封装和保护对象的属性,避免直接访问和修改属性引发的错误。 2. 如何正确使用Java中的get和set方法?